In the 1881 Census, the household of Samuel Byatt, born in 1855 in Westminster, Middlesex, consisted of 4 members. Samuel was the head of the household, married to Mary A Byatt, born in 1859 in Bedfordshire, England. They had 1 child; Annie, born 1881 in Stratford, Essex, England.
During the period, also present in the household was Samuel's Brother, Thomas Stone, born in 1862 in Romford, Essex, England.
